Our Women’s Football Jerseys: Materials That Changed the Game
Premium Material System (Built for Training and Match Play)
- Moisture-wicking polyester micro-mesh: Transports sweat, dries faster, keeps body cool.
- Lycra/Spandex stretch zones: Ensures freedom of movement in sprint and defense.
- Laser micro-perforation: Targeted airflow zones (underarms, upper back) improve thermoregulation.
- Colorfast yarns for sublimation: Long-lasting, bright club colors that resist fading.
- OEKO-TEX® certified: Ensures safety, especially in youth categories.
Why this beats ordinary stock jerseys: Surface inks crack, cotton holds sweat; engineered fibers stay lighter, cleaner, and stronger over repeated washes.
Produção & Engineering: From Pattern to Print
Athlete-First Patterning
- 3D-graded blocks from youth to adult, adapted to female shoulder slope and torso length.
- Collar/cuff reinforcement to avoid sagging or irritation.
- Bartack stitching in stress zones for long-lasting strength.
Manufacturing & Color Management
- Computer-guided cutting ensures symmetry and reduces waste.
- Flatlock seams reduce chafing during extended wear.
- ICC-profiled sublimation guarantees brand color consistency across batches.
- Quality assurance: wash tests, tensile checks, colorfast validation.

Robert Ng (Technical Consultant):
“Sublimation ensures colors stay vibrant, and breathable jerseys are critical in congested match schedules.”
Ng draws on his two decades of consulting with semi-professional and professional clubs in Asia and Europe. He notes that sublimation printing embeds dye into the fiber itself rather than sitting on the surface.
This means that sponsor logos, números dos jogadores, and club crests remain intact after 50+ ciclos de lavagem, a factor that reduces mid-season uniform replacement costs. Beyond aesthetics, Ng stresses the importance of breathability in leagues with congested fixture calendars. “A breathable jersey helps with recovery,” he explains, “because lower skin temperature and reduced heat stress translate to less muscular fatigue across multiple games per week.” His insight confirms why sublimation is now the industry standard for both men’s and women’s elite football kits.

Scientific Data
- Moisture & drying: Studies show polyester knits dry 30–50% faster than cotton.
- Thermal regulation: Fabric air-permeability improves heat exchange and reduces perceived exertion.
- Durabilidade: Sublimation lasts 2–3× longer than surface ink printing in wash-cycle testing.
- Sustentabilidade: Recycled polyester jerseys reduce environmental footprint in LCAs.

Perguntas frequentes
1. What fabrics are best for women’s camisas de futebol?
Micro-mesh polyester with Lycra panels for breathability and flexibility.
2. Are sublimated jerseys more durable than printed ones?
Sim, sublimation bonds dye into fibers, preventing cracks and peeling.
3. Do women’s jerseys differ from men’s in sizing?
Sim, they feature tailored cuts, shorter torso lengths, and adjusted shoulder slopes.
4. Can schools customize jerseys for tournaments?
Sim, but they must comply with numbering, cor, and sponsorship rules.
5. Are recycled materials used in women’s football jerseys?
Sim, recycled polyester is increasingly adopted for eco-friendly kits.
